License and Regulation
Perhaps the most critical aspect of evaluating an online casino platform is verifying its licensing and regulatory status. In the United Kingdom, the Gambling Commission is the primary regulatory body responsible for overseeing all forms of gambling, including online casinos. A legitimate platform operating legally within the UK must hold a valid license from the Gambling Commission. This license signifies that the platform ad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. You can verify a platform's license status on the Gambling Commission's official website.
The presence of a UK Gambling Commission license isn’t a guarantee of a flawless experience, but it does offer a significant level of protection to players. The Commission has the power to investigate complaints, impose sanctions, and even revoke licenses from operators who fail to comply with regulations. Therefore, choosing a platform licensed by the UK Gambling Commission is a crucial step in safeguarding your funds and ensuring a fair gaming environment.

Responsible Gaming: A Cornerstone of Enjoyment
While the excitement and potential rewards of online casinos can be alluring, it is essential to prioritize responsible gaming practices. This involves setting limits on both time and money spent, recognizing the signs of problem gambling, and utilizing available resources to maintain control. Responsible gaming isn’t about preventing all gambling; it's about ensuring that it remains a form of entertainment rather than a source of stress or financial hardship. Establishing a budget before playing is paramount. This budget should be an amount that you can comfortably afford to lose without impacting your essential financial obligations.
Equally important is setting time limits. Spending excessive amounts of time gambling can lead to neglecting other important aspects of life, such as work, family, and social activities. Utilizing features offered by some platforms, such as self-exclusion options, can provide a valuable tool for regaining control. Self-exclusion allows you to voluntarily ban yourself from accessing the platform for a specified period.
Recognizing Problem Gambling
Problem gambling can manifest in various ways. Common signs include chasing losses, gambling with money intended for essential expenses, lying to others about gambling habits, and exper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. If you or someone you know is exhibiting these behaviors, it’s crucial to seek help. Denial is a common characteristic of problem gambling, making it difficult for individuals to recognize the severity of their situation.
Fortunately, numerous resources are available to assist those struggling with problem gambling. Organizations like GamCare and BeGambleAware provide confidential support, counseling, and information. These organizations offer a non-judgmental environment where individuals can discuss their concerns and develop strategies for overcoming their challenges.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.

Understanding Bonus Offers and Wagering Requirements
Online casinos frequently entice new players with bonus offers, such as welcome bonuses, deposit matches, and free spins. While these offers can be appealing, it's crucial to understand the associated terms and conditions, particularly wagering requirements. Wagering requirements dictate the amount of money you must wager before being able to withdraw any winnings generated from a bonus. These requirements vary significantly between platforms, and can often be quite substantial.
For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any associated winnings. Failing to meet these requirements can result in the forfeiture of both the bonus and any winnings derived from it. Carefully reviewing the terms and conditions, including any game restrictions or time limitations, is essential before accepting a bonus offer. Understanding these nuances is key to maximizing the value of bonuses and avoiding disappointment.
Impact on Gameplay
Wagering requirements can significantly impact your gameplay experience. They can force you to play games you wouldn’t normally choose, simply to meet the requirements. They can also prolong the time it takes to withdraw your winnings, potentially leading to frustration. Therefore, it’s important to assess whether the benefits of a bonus outweigh the associated wagering requirements. Consider your preferred games and your typical betting habits when evaluating a bonus offer.
Some players may prefer to decline bonuses altogether, opting instead to play with their own funds without any restrictions. This approach provides greater flexibility and avoids the potential pitfalls of wagering requirements.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to accept a bonus is a personal one, based on your individual preferences and playing style.
